Barron’s is seeking an experienced journalist to lead and own a premium newsletter designed to engage a community of savvy investors.
We see newsletters as a powerful platform to deliver sharp, original insights and actionable market guidance. This new offering—published at least weekly—will provide timely analysis of market trends, highlight Barron’s stock picks, and offer technical takes on notable names, helping readers make sense of recent developments and prepare for what’s ahead.
This role is about more than reporting; it’s about building a dynamic community of smart investors. You’ll experiment with formats and strategies to foster engagement—spotlighting sentiment and inviting direct interaction. Your voice will be authoritative, clear, and accessible, weaving together macro and sector-level news into a compelling, digestible narrative that connects the dots for retail investors.
We’re looking for someone who excels at interpreting market moves and their implications. You should have a strong editorial sensibility, a knack for simplifying complex topics, and a proven track record of audience engagement.
This role involves close collaboration with Barron’s journalists, stock pickers, strategists, and technical analysts. Familiarity with visual storytelling—charts, tools, and graphics—is a must.
The role will be based in New York, though other locations will be considered on merit.
Responsibilities:
Assume full responsibility for weekly newsletter.
Collaborate with colleagues and other departments to perform research, promote reader engagement, brainstorm on ideas and receive feedback
Write jargon-free, clear financial prose
Closely follow markets to determine which stocks and sectors may be of particular interest based on news, and should be flagged for readers
Qualifications:
A track record of writing a unique, engaging newsletter
Deep understanding of financial markets and news that impacts investors
Preferably three to five years of experience writing on investing platforms
Facility with SEO and audience strategies
Ability to communicate with investors of all stripes in a clear and respectful way
You will:
Work well under pressure and with other members of the team
Be responsive to the community in a timely fashion
Actively seek new ways to engage the community via surveys, competitions, shoutouts, and more
About the Role/Barron’s:
You will craft a weekly newsletter, as part of a team of writers, and report to The Barron’s Investor Circle Managing Editor.
